WebbThe acronym PERMA displays the five elements of the well being theory: Positive Emotions, Engagement, Relationships, Meaning and purpose, and Accomplishments. Positive emotions include happiness, joy, pride, satisfaction, empathy, pride, awe, … Webb1 feb. 2000 · Seligman and Csikszentmihalyi (2000) describes positive psychology as combination of indicators which make life worth living. WebbHistorically, there are two behavioral psychology theories: methodological behaviorism and radical behaviorism (Moore, 2013). The methodological theory is the original behaviorism established by Watson, with the goal of predicting and controlling behavior.
